Heliofungia actiniformis, commonly known as the Plate Coral or Tentacle Coral, is a captivating large polyp stony (LPS) coral prized for its distinctive, anemone-like tentacles and vibrant purple colouring. Lighting Requirements: Moderate lighting is recommended to maintain vibrant colouration and healthy growth. Avoid intense direct lighting as this may cause bleaching or stress.
Water Flow: Low to moderate water flow is ideal. Strong currents can damage the delicate tentacles, while gentle flow helps remove detritus and supports respiration.
Placement: Position the coral on a stable substrate or rockwork with enough open space around it to accommodate its extended tentacles. Ensure it is not placed too close to aggressive neighbouring corals to prevent stinging or damage.
Care Level: Suitable for intermediate to advanced hobbyists due to its specific flow and lighting needs and space requirements.
Diet: Primarily photosynthetic via symbiotic zooxanthellae but benefits from supplemental feeding of meaty foods such as brine shrimp, mysis shrimp, or specialised coral foods 1-2 times per week.
Reef Compatibility: Yes, with adequate spacing. It is generally reef safe but can sting nearby corals if placed too close.
Minimum Tank Size: A minimum of 90 litres (approximately 20 gallons) is recommended to provide stable water parameters and sufficient space.

Maximum Size: Can reach up to 30 cm (12 inches) in diameter under optimal conditions.
